The problem that is occurring with Firefox is one website American Airlines, I can not log in to my account with Firefox, however Chrome has no problem logging in. Running Windows 11 up to date Firefox 147.03 64 bit. below is the error message I get Access Denied You don't have permission to access "http://www.aa.com/homePage.do" on this server.

Reference #18.450c3417.1770423478.9f1ea295

https://errors.edgesuite.net/18.450c3417.1770423478.9f1ea295

Thanks for any help. Rick

Windows, home or pro and what security software are you running besides MS Defender? It works for me. see screenshot

Did you try with Firefox in Troubleshoot Mode? https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/diagnose-firefox-issues-using-troubleshoot-mode#w_how-to-start-firefox-in-4troubleshoot-modesf5safe-modesf

Did you try clearing the browser cache? https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/how-clear-firefox-cache#
